About

Roundway is a residential street located in the Harringay Ladder neighbourhood of Haringey. The area is characterised by long, straight roads of Victorian and Edwardian terraced houses, with Roundway itself running parallel to the main commercial spine of Green Lanes. The local architecture is primarily two-storey brick homes, many with small front gardens. The layout is a grid pattern typical of this part of north London, creating a series of quiet, interconnected streets.

The immediate area is served by local shops and amenities along nearby sections of Green Lanes. Finsbury Park is a short walk to the west, providing a large green space for recreation. A specific local landmark is the Salisbury Hotel, a Victorian pub on the corner of Green Lanes and St Ann's Road, which has been a fixture for over a century. Public transport access is provided by several bus routes along the main roads.

Area overview

On average Roundway has very high deprivation and average crime levels, with around 79 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 39% below the London average of 130 per 1,000. Approximately 44.3%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Roundway is £58,175 per year. On average most houses in the area have average public transport connectivity. Roundway is home to around 6,864 people, with a population density of about 9,194.9 per km².
